PH Embassy in Ottawa Launches ABAKADA Atbp., Brings Filipino Stories To Children’s Homes
The Philippine Embassy in Ottawa launches its ABAKADA Atbp. Book Giveaway for Filipino-Canadian children as part of its commemoration of August as Buwan ng Wika (National Language Month). (Ottawa PE photo)
OTTAWA 18 August 2020 – The Philippine Embassy in Ottawa recently launched its ABAKADA Atbp. Book Giveaway for Filipino-Canadian children as part of its commemoration of Buwan ng Wikang Pambansa (National Language Month) in the month of August. Beloved Filipino legends and children’s stories written in English and Filipino, published by Adarna House, were mailed to participating children this month as part of the Embassy’s Online ABAKADA Atbp. program.
According to Philippine Ambassador to Canada Petronila P. Garcia, ABAKADA was originally conceptualized as a summer workshop for children of Filipino heritage. Now in its eighth year, the program teaches Filipino language, songs, games, dances, cuisine, and stories. “This year, we are unable to host the children for our annual summer workshop for health and safety reasons, but we would like to bring the stories of our Filipino culture straight to their homes,” said Ambassador Garcia. “We hope this will be an opportunity for Filipino parents to share the stories that have been passed down through generations and, at the same time, introduce the Filipino language to their children,” added the Ambassador.
